## Deployment

The Farrowtide tax-rate cache deploys via the standard Lintbarrow pipeline. Warm the cache before cutover; cold starts spike lookup latency for two minutes. Verify the invalidation webhook fires after rates publish. Release manager signs off once hit rate exceeds 95%. Production deploys with the following configuration values.

service settings:
[casax]
port = 6379
team = rusir
host = casax.zemvarhq.corp
region = outer-4
access_code = ac_9808ce
timeout_ms = 1500

**Handover: monthly partitioning for event_log — for the eng sync**

Handing off the Quillbrook event_log partitioning work to Dasha. Partitions are now created by month via a scheduled job, with a two-month lookahead so inserts never miss a target. Old partitions detach after the retention window rather than dropping immediately, giving us a recovery buffer. Nothing else changed in the write path. The partition manager currently runs with the following settings.

config for yadug-kawep:
ralwyn:
  log_level: debug
  metrics_host: metrics.ralwyn.qorvellabs.internal
  pool_size: 4

Subject: Timezone fix for report exports — shipped

Hey all, quick note for whoever touches Lanternwick exports next: we now pin all timestamps to the workspace timezone instead of the server clock, so nightly reports stop drifting an hour after DST flips. Docs updated in the maintainers' wiki. This landed in the build below, for reference:

session token of yajof-bagef = htk4_937d

### Timeline — 14:22

The Brushfall cleanup bot, intended to archive branches idle for 90 days, began deleting branches referenced by open reviews because the review index had not refreshed. On-call paused the bot at 14:29 and restored branches from reflog snapshots. For context, the offending run can be identified by the trace token below.

build token for fajof-yahof: htk4_869f